3.6
Manual motor direction of rotation check (manual control)
The »Engineer« function "Manual control" easily allows for controlling the direction of rotation of
the motor. The manual control serves to let the motor connected to the inverter with an adjustable
speed for an adjustable time.
How to carry out a manual motor direction of rotation check using the »Engineer«:
1. Go to the
Project view
and select the 8400 HighLine inverter.
2.
Going online.
After a connection to the inverter has been established, the following status is displayed in
the
Status line
:
3. Click the
symbol to inhibit the inverter via device command.
4. Ensure that the following conditions are met:
• The mains voltage is switched on.
• No trouble is active.
• Safe torque off (STO) is not active.
5. Enable inverter via terminal: Set terminal X5/RFR to HIGH level.
6. Click the
icon to open the
Manual motor rotation indication
dialog box.
Note:
If the "not ready for operation" status is displayed, check whether all conditions
mentioned before (see steps 3 ... 5) have been met.
7. Set the desired speed and runtime.
(The speed refers to the reference speed set in
.)
8. Click the
button to let the motor rotate with the set speed for the set runtime.
By clicking the
button, the function can be aborted.
